Dallas Holocaust and Human Rights Museum (Museum)
300 N Houston StDallas Holocaust and Human Rights Museum is most popular around 2 PM on Saturdays. Visitors usually stay up to 3 hours here. It's most quiet on Wednesdays.
The Dallas Holocaust and Human Rights Museum tells the story of the Holocaust, the emergence of international human rights following the war, and the development of human and civil rights in America. We are dedicated to teaching the history of the Holocaust and advancing human rights to combat prejudice, hatred, and indifference.
